Output 1640ddccfb959366a4889c518fc69d43858640039c6fad462ebaf9c7faa0a14c:13

value
485707
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8bb54259907a49ad1d1ff203bbe465ed45ccb4bf OP_EQUAL
address
3ERizKKmADX6B2q5PT7CrUD6o7kikpNrHE
transaction
1640ddccfb959366a4889c518fc69d43858640039c6fad462ebaf9c7faa0a14c
confirmations
181292
spent
true